A Symphony of Landscapes:

Malaysia boasts a remarkable array of landscapes, offering a perfect blend of natural beauty and urban vibrancy. From the lush rainforests of Borneo to the pristine beaches of Langkawi, the country caters to every traveler’s taste.

  • Island Escapes: The islands of Langkawi, Tioman, and Perhentian are renowned for their idyllic beaches, crystal-clear waters, and diverse marine life. These destinations offer opportunities for snorkeling, diving, kayaking, and simply relaxing on the sand.

  • Jungle Adventures: For adventurous souls, the rainforests of Borneo and the Taman Negara National Park provide an immersive experience. Trek through dense jungles, encounter exotic wildlife, and marvel at the towering canopy.

  • Urban Exploration: The bustling cities of Kuala Lumpur and Penang offer a unique blend of modern architecture, colonial heritage, and vibrant street life. Explore iconic landmarks, indulge in delicious street food, and experience the pulse of urban Malaysia.

A Tapestry of Cultures:

Malaysia’s rich cultural heritage is a testament to its diverse history. The country is home to a harmonious blend of Malay, Chinese, Indian, and indigenous communities, each contributing to the vibrant tapestry of traditions, languages, and cuisines.

  • Cultural Immersion: Visit traditional villages, attend cultural festivals, and immerse oneself in the customs and traditions of Malaysia’s diverse communities.

  • Religious Diversity: Explore the magnificent mosques, temples, and churches that dot the landscape, reflecting the country’s religious tolerance and harmony.

  • Culinary Delights: Indulge in the flavorful cuisine of Malaysia, a fusion of Malay, Chinese, Indian, and indigenous influences. From spicy curries to fragrant rice dishes, the country offers a culinary adventure for every palate.

A Year of Festivities:

2025 promises a vibrant calendar of events and festivals, adding to the allure of a Malaysian holiday.

  • The Thaipusam Festival: This Hindu festival, celebrated in January or February, is a spectacle of colorful processions, devotional rituals, and vibrant decorations.

  • The Hari Raya Aidilfitri Festival: The Muslim festival of Eid al-Fitr, celebrated in April or May, marks the end of Ramadan and is characterized by joyous celebrations, family gatherings, and delicious traditional dishes.

  • The Chinese New Year: This annual celebration, usually in January or February, brings with it vibrant decorations, lion dances, and festive feasts.

Beyond the Tourist Trail:

While popular destinations offer their unique charm, venturing off the beaten path reveals hidden gems and authentic experiences.

  • The Cameron Highlands: This cool-climate hill station offers breathtaking scenery, tea plantations, and opportunities for hiking and exploring the local culture.

  • The Kinabalu National Park: Nestled in Sabah, Borneo, this park boasts Mount Kinabalu, the highest peak in Southeast Asia, and offers challenging climbs and breathtaking views.

  • The Sarawak Cultural Village: This living museum showcases the traditional lifestyles of Sarawak’s indigenous communities, offering a glimpse into their unique customs, crafts, and traditions.

FAQs about Holidays to Malaysia in 2025:

Q: What is the best time to visit Malaysia?

A: Malaysia enjoys a tropical climate, with year-round sunshine. However, the best time to visit depends on your preferences. The dry season, from March to October, offers sunny skies and minimal rainfall, ideal for beach vacations and outdoor activities. The monsoon season, from November to February, brings heavier rainfall, but also cooler temperatures and lush greenery.

Q: What are the visa requirements for entering Malaysia?

A: Visa requirements vary depending on your nationality. Many nationalities are granted visa-free entry for a specific duration. However, it is essential to check the latest visa regulations before your trip.

Q: What are the safety considerations for travelers in Malaysia?

A: Malaysia is generally a safe country for tourists. However, it is advisable to take standard precautions, such as being aware of your surroundings, keeping valuables secure, and avoiding isolated areas at night.

Q: What are the currency and payment methods in Malaysia?

A: The official currency of Malaysia is the Malaysian Ringgit (MYR). Credit cards are widely accepted in major cities and tourist areas, but cash is still preferred in smaller towns and villages.

Q: What are the transportation options in Malaysia?

A: Malaysia has a well-developed transportation network, with domestic flights, trains, buses, and taxis available. For exploring cities, local transportation options include buses, taxis, and ride-hailing services.
